Karen M. Henkels has authored 42 papers that have received a total of 1.2k indexed citations.
This includes 34 papers in Molecular Biology, 11 papers in Physiology and 11 papers in Cell Biology. The topics of these papers are Protein Kinase Regulation and GTPase Signaling (12 papers), Erythrocyte Function and Pathophysiology (8 papers) and PI3K/AKT/mTOR signaling in cancer (7 papers). Karen M. Henkels is often cited by papers focused on Protein Kinase Regulation and GTPase Signaling (12 papers), Erythrocyte Function and Pathophysiology (8 papers) and PI3K/AKT/mTOR signaling in cancer (7 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in United States and Japan. Karen M. Henkels's co-authors include Julián Gómez-Cambronero, Madhu Mahankali, John J. Turchi, Kathleen Frondorf and Hong‐Juan Peng and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Journal of Molecular Biology.
